This is a very good softcover copy with just light cover wear. Completely clean inside, very clean outside. Text in French and English. for an opera performed at Theatre des Varietes, for the Festival d' Automne in December and January of 1974-75. This was one of Robert Wilson's earliest pieces first performed at the Spoleto Festival in June of 1974. Robert Wilson's 80 year old grandmother starred in it. The production toured Europe for two years. Robert Wilson founded the Byrd Hoffman School of Byrds, an experimental theater group in Soho in 1968. A pamphlet titled 'Robert Wilson: Byrd Hoffman, School of Byrds' laid in. This has a 7 page essay by Bonnie Marranca and a sheet of four black & white photographs of the performance, in 1974, with Christopher Knowles, Cynthia Lubar, Alma Hamilton, Sheryl Sutton, George Ashley, Stefan Brecht, and Scotty Snyder, taken by Johan Elbers. 8" high X 6" wide, 152 pages.
